What Pink Camera to get for missus??
I'm thinking of getting the missus a digital compact camera for Xmas... thing is she is one of these girls that goes for stuff because 'It looks nice'... and with this in mind she would want her camera to be pink (typical bint).
Anyway, which pink compact would you lot recommend for under £130.
Here is a list of some that I have been having a nose at: -
Casio Exilim EX-Z1050... 10.1mp, 3x Opt Zoom, 4x Dig Zoom
Fujifilm FinePix Z10fd... 7.24mp, 3x Opt Zoom, 4.8x Dig Zoom
Sony CyberShot DSC-W80... 7.2mp, 3x Opt Zoom, 2x Dig Zoom
Panasonic Lumix DMC-FX33... 8.1mp, 3.6x Opt Zoom, 4x Dig Zoom
